Landscape with Tobias and the Angel is an ink print by the Baroque artist Gilles Neyts. It dates from 1655 and is held in the collection of the National Gallery of Art.

Gilles Neyts’ 1655 etching, Landscape with Tobias and the Angel, presents a tranquil woodland setting rendered on laid paper. The composition centers on two figures positioned beside a mature tree, one kneeling and the other gesturing upward, while a modest stream winds through the foreground. A domed structure emerges faintly among the foliage in the distance, adding a subtle architectural reference to the otherwise natural scene.

Subject & Meaning

The work draws on the biblical episode of Tobias and the Archangel Raphael, a narrative often associated with guidance and healing. By placing the pair in a serene forest, Neyts emphasizes the theme of divine assistance within the everyday world, suggesting a contemplative pause in nature where the angel’s counsel is offered.

Technique & Style

Executed as an etching, the image relies on delicate, intersecting lines to model foliage, water, and architectural details. Neyts’ handling of the plate creates a fine texture in the leaves and rippling surface of the stream, while the contrast of deep shadows and light strokes gives the scene depth without resorting to heavy cross‑hatching.

History & Provenance

Created in the mid‑seventeenth century, the print reflects Neyts’ reputation as a skilled draughtsman of landscapes and his interest in biblical subjects. While specific ownership records for this particular impression are scarce, the work is documented among Neyts’ printed oeuvre and appears in several catalogues of Flemish etchings from the period.
